Electric reactors play a pivotal role in various industries, particularly in the fields of energy production, chemical processing, and manufacturing. Understanding the factors that influence electric reactor purchase decisions can significantly benefit potential buyers in making informed choices that align with their operational needs.

One critical factor is the technical specifications of the electric reactor. Buyers often focus on attributes like power capacity, design type, and operational efficiency. According to a study by Market Research Future, the demand for high-efficiency electric reactors is projected to grow at a CAGR of 6.8% from 2021 to 2027. This growth is driven by the increasing need for advanced technology to enhance productivity and reduce energy consumption.
Cost-effectiveness is another vital concern for purchasers. The initial capital investment, as well as the long-term operational and maintenance costs, are heavily scrutinized. A survey conducted by Research and Markets revealed that approximately 54% of procurement managers prioritize cost as the most significant factor in their purchasing decisions. This statistic emphasizes the need for manufacturers to offer competitive pricing while maintaining quality standards.
The reputation and reliability of manufacturers also dramatically affect purchasing decisions. According to a recent report by Statista, 76% of industry professionals consider a manufacturer’s track record when selecting an electric reactor supplier. This indicates that established brands with proven performance records generally have an edge in the market. Buyers often seek testimonials and case studies to gauge the reliability of the equipment they are considering.
Moreover, compliance with industry standards and regulations is crucial. The chemical and energy industries are heavily regulated, and non-compliance can lead to significant financial penalties and operational disruptions. A report from the National Institute of Standards and Technology found that about 67% of companies highlight regulatory compliance as a key factor in their selection process for industrial equipment, including electric reactors.
Sales and service support also play a fundamental role in the decision-making process. According to a survey by Deloitte, 58% of electric reactor users reported that post-purchase support, including maintenance and repair services, heavily influenced their initial purchasing decision. Manufacturers who can provide robust customer support and service packages are likely to build stronger relationships with their clients and encourage repeat business.
Another essential factor is technological advancements. As integration of smart technology into equipment becomes commonplace, buyers are increasingly interested in electric reactors that offer digital capabilities. A study by McKinsey indicates that about 72% of businesses are investing in smart technology solutions to streamline operations and enhance productivity. Electric reactors that incorporate advanced monitoring and control features are more likely to attract purchases from tech-savvy companies.
Environmental considerations are also becoming more prominent in purchasing decisions. With a global shift toward sustainability, many organizations are evaluating the environmental impact of their operations. According to the Global Industry Analysts, approximately 48% of buyers prefer electric reactors that are energy-efficient and reduce carbon footprints. Companies that can demonstrate their commitment to sustainability often find themselves at an advantage in the market.
Moreover, the availability of financing and leasing options can incentivize purchases. According to industry insights from LeaseAccelerator, 63% of businesses find that flexible financing options significantly influence their decision to acquire new equipment, including electric reactors. Offering varied financial solutions can help manufacturers appeal to a broader spectrum of buyers.
Finally, personalized solutions tailored to specific industry needs can drive purchasing decisions. Research by Frost & Sullivan indicates that about 59% of purchasing managers favor suppliers who can customize equipment to meet unique operational demands. Electric reactor manufacturers that develop tailored solutions are more likely to forge lasting partnerships with their clients.
In conclusion, the decision to purchase electric reactors is influenced by a multitude of factors including technical specifications, cost-effectiveness, manufacturer's reputation, regulatory compliance, customer support, technological advancements, environmental considerations, financing options, and personalized solutions. By understanding these critical elements, potential buyers can navigate their purchasing decisions more effectively and select electric reactors that best fit their needs.
The understanding of these factors can not only facilitate a more efficient purchasing process but also lead to better operational outcomes in the long run.
